Sourcing guidance for Vehicle Scanner Price
What are the key technical factors that influence the price of vehicle scanners?
The price of vehicle scanners is primarily determined by diagnostic depth and system coverage. Basic OBDII code readers are the most affordable, while professional-grade bi-directional scanners that support ECU coding, active tests, and key programming command a premium. Additionally, hardware specifications such as processor speed, RAM (4GB+ recommended), and screen resolution significantly impact the cost and user experience.
How do software updates and subscription models affect the total cost of ownership?
Buyers must distinguish between one-time purchase costs and recurring subscription fees. Many high-end scanners include 1 to 3 years of free software updates, after which an annual fee (typically $100–$800) is required to access the latest vehicle models and functions. What compliance standards should I verify for international trade of electronic diagnostic tools?
To ensure smooth customs clearance and market entry, verify that the scanners carry CE, FCC, and RoHS certifications. For the European market, REACH compliance is often necessary. If the scanner includes wireless components (Bluetooth/Wi-Fi), ensure it meets local radio frequency regulations to avoid legal complications during import.
What are the differences between handheld scanners and VCI-based tablet systems in terms of value?
Handheld units are cost-effective and durable for DIY or basic roadside assistance. However, VCI (Vehicle Communication Interface) tablet systems offer better value for workshops because they allow for wireless diagnostics via Bluetooth/VCI, enabling technicians to move around the vehicle. These systems often integrate repair databases and wiring diagrams, justifying a higher price point.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Vehicle Scanners
How can I mitigate the risk of purchasing counterfeit or 'locked' diagnostic hardware?
Always source from verified manufacturers or authorized distributors on Made-in-China.com. Request the Product Serial Number (S/N) before shipping to verify the regional version. Some scanners are 'IP-locked' to specific regions (e.g., China-only versions); ensure the supplier provides a Global Version to avoid software lockout upon activation in your country.
What strategies should be used when negotiating bulk pricing for automotive electronics?
Focus on the software-to-hardware ratio. Since hardware margins are slim, negotiate for extended software update periods or additional connector adapters (like BMW 20-pin or Benz 38-pin) rather than just a lower unit price. For orders exceeding 50 units, request OEM/White-labeling services to add your brand logo to the boot screen and exterior casing.
What are the best practices for shipping sensitive electronic diagnostic equipment?
Vehicle scanners contain lithium batteries, which are classified as Dangerous Goods (UN3481). Ensure the supplier uses UN-certified packaging and provides a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S). For shipping to the US or Europe, Air Freight with specialized electronics couriers is recommended to minimize vibration damage and ensure faster turnover of high-value inventory.
